AI News HubLIVE
站內改寫2 分鐘閱讀

Show HN: Tokdash – 本地AI令牌與配額追蹤儀表盤

Tokdash 是一款開源的本地儀表盤工具,用於精確追蹤 AI 客户端(如 Claude Code、Codex)的令牌使用量和配額。它提供令牌計數、貢獻熱力圖、會話分析、配額監控等功能,並支持 Tailscale 遠程訪問。

來源Hacker News AI作者: howardme1

Tokdash 是一款面向 AI 開發者的開源本地儀表盤工具,旨在幫助用户精確追蹤和管理 AI 客户端(如 Claude Code、Codex 等)的令牌使用量和配額。該項目已在 GitHub 上開源,並獲得了社區的積極反饋。

Tokdash 的核心功能包括精確的令牌計數(輸入/輸出/緩存分解)、貢獻日曆熱力圖(2D 和 3D 視圖)、會話探索器以及配額監控標籤頁。配額標籤頁支持顯示訂閲週期進度條和重置倒計時,適用於 Codex、Claude Code 等平台。此外,Tokdash 還支持狀態欄集成,允許用户在 Claude Code 等代理的 statusline 中實時查看令牌和成本數據。

安裝非常簡便,推薦使用 pipx 進行隔離安裝:pipx install tokdash。首次運行通過 tokdash setup 啓動向導,配置後台服務並打印儀表盤 URL(默認 http://127.0.0.1:55423)。用户還可以使用 tokdash doctor 進行環境檢查,tokdash update 進行升級,tokdash uninstall 進行卸載。

Tokdash 默認僅綁定到本地迴環地址,保障數據安全。對於遠程訪問,建議使用 Tailscale Serve 或 SSH 隧道。Tailscale Serve 配置簡單,嚮導可自動完成設置,但遠程訪問僅支持只讀操作,寫入操作需通過 SSH 轉發。

Tokdash 還支持持久化使用數據庫(默認啓用),將解析後的令牌數據存儲在 SQLite 索引中,提高重複查詢性能。用户可通過環境變量自定義數據目錄、緩存時間、併發限制等。整體設計注重隱私和安全性,無遙測功能,所有數據解析均在本地完成。

該項目目前處於活躍開發階段,已支持 Linux(包括 WSL2)、macOS,Windows 為實驗性支持。未來計劃包括更多客户端的兼容性改進和功能擴展。Tokdash 的配置選項非常豐富,包括 TOKDASH_HOST、TOKDASH_PORT、TOKDASH_CACHE_TTL 等環境變量,以及持久化數據庫的配置。此外,Tokdash 還支持通過 tokdash db 系列命令進行數據庫維護,如狀態檢查、同步、驗證和修復。

對於使用配額監控的用户,Tokdash 提供了可選的配額輪詢功能,需要通過 tokdash quota consent 啓用,並使用本地 CLI 憑證調用提供商自己的配額端點。所有響應數據存儲在本地 SQLite 數據庫中。

Tokdash 的安裝嚮導還支持從舊版本遷移,例如從 v1.0 之前的版本升級時,需要先升級 tokdash 命令,然後運行 tokdash setup 以接管後台服務。對於使用 conda 或系統 Python 的用户,可以遷移到 Tokdash 管理的虛擬環境。

總之,Tokdash 是一個功能強大且注重隱私的本地儀表盤工具,適合所有希望精確控制 AI 令牌使用和配額的開發者和團隊。